Tinana South QLD — Suburb Profile
Population, median income, rent prices, housing costs and demographics for Tinana South, Queensland. ABS Census 2021.
The population of Tinana South QLD is 545 according to the 2021 Census. The median personal income in Tinana South is $740 per week ($38,480 per year). Median rent in Tinana South is $290 per week ($1,257 per month). Tinana South has a median age of 45 years, older than the national median of 38. Tinana South has a population density of 21.2 people per km².
The most common overseas birthplace in Tinana South is England. The most common religion is No Religion (39% of residents). After English, the most spoken language is Other. The median monthly mortgage repayment in Tinana South is $1,509.

What is the median income in Tinana South?
The median personal income in Tinana South QLD is $740 per week, or $38,480 per year.The median household income is $1,636 per week.Family income is $1,864 per week.Tinana South is ranked #4,735 by income out of 14,663 Australian suburbs.
How much is rent in Tinana South?
Median rent in Tinana South QLD is $290 per week ($1,257 per month).Rent represents 17.7% of household income, which is considered affordable.Tinana South ranks #5,154 out of 14,663 suburbs by rent.
